:root {
    --color-primary-default: #1351b4;
    --color-secondary-01: #fff;
    --interactive: var(--color-primary-default);
    --font-size-scale-up-01: 16.8px;
    --font-weight-semi-bold: 600;
    --rgb-primary-default: 19, 81, 180;
    --rgb-secundary-01: 255, 255, 255;
    --spacing-scale-3x: 24px;
}

.br-button {
  --button-background: var(--color-primary-default);
  --button-border: var(--color-secondary-01);
  --button-color: #fff;
  --button-radius: 100em;
  --button-font-size: var(--font-size-scale-up-01);
  --button-font-weight: var(--font-weight-semi-bold);
  --button-xsmall: 24px;
  --button-small: 32px;
  --button-medium: 40px;
  --button-large: 48px;
  --button-size: var(--button-medium);
  --button-padding: 0 var(--spacing-scale-3x);
  --button-img: 20px;
  --interactive-rgb: var(--rgb-secundary-01);
  align-items: center;
  background-color: var(--button-background);
  border: 1px solid var(--button-border);
  border-radius: var(--button-radius);
  color: var(--button-color);
  cursor: pointer;
  display: inline-flex;
  font-size: var(--button-font-size);
/*  font-weight: var(--button-font-weight);*/
  height: var(--button-size);
  justify-content: center;
  padding: var(--button-padding);
  text-align: center;
  vertical-align: middle;
  white-space: nowrap;
  width: auto;
}


